Circuit engineering, within the context of cryptocurrency derivatives, fundamentally involves the design and implementation of automated trading algorithms optimized for specific market conditions and risk profiles. These algorithms leverage quantitative models, often incorporating machine learning techniques, to identify and execute trading opportunities across options, futures, and perpetual swaps. A core focus is on minimizing slippage and latency, crucial factors in high-frequency trading environments, while adhering to pre-defined risk management parameters. The efficacy of these algorithms is continuously evaluated through rigorous backtesting and live simulation, adapting to evolving market dynamics and regulatory landscapes.
